What should I do to learn spoken English without any coaching classes?

You can begin by watching BBC and CNN. You can also watch English movies with subtitles. You can read The Hindu. You can try and converse in English with your friends and colleagues.

For a student with any other language as their mother tongue, the first thing they need to learn is the basic vocublary and pronunciation of various words. Also the grammar rules which is used widely and they should start using English words in their day to day life. So that a habit can be developed throughout the time. Coaching classes are required just for the environment of english speaking people. If you can create it by yourself with your family or friends then I guess you don't need any particular classes. You can work on it by yourself. Hope this would be helpful. read less
